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Sign in / Register
Toggle navigation
Y
YGOMobile
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Locked Files
Issues
0
Issues
0
List
Boards
Labels
Service Desk
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Security & Compliance
Security & Compliance
Dependency List
License Compliance
Packages
Packages
List
Container Registry
Analytics
Analytics
CI / CD
Code Review
Insights
Issues
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
fallenstardust
YGOMobile
Commits
d9556126
Commit
d9556126
authored
Jul 26, 2018
by
fallenstardust
Browse files
Options
Browse Files
Download
Plain Diff
Merge branch 'master' of
https://gitee.com/bdnh/hippo
parents
4b261507
61ca6449
Changes
10
Hide whitespace changes
Inline
Side-by-side
Showing
10 changed files
with
32 additions
and
36 deletions
+32
-36
build.gradle
build.gradle
+1
-0
mobile/assets/changelog.html
mobile/assets/changelog.html
+1
-0
mobile/build.gradle
mobile/build.gradle
+1
-1
mobile/libs/360update-7.0.3.jar
mobile/libs/360update-7.0.3.jar
+0
-0
mobile/libs/armeabi-v7a/libarmeabi.so
mobile/libs/armeabi-v7a/libarmeabi.so
+0
-0
mobile/libs/pgyer_sdk_3.0.0.jar
mobile/libs/pgyer_sdk_3.0.0.jar
+0
-0
mobile/src/main/AndroidManifest.xml
mobile/src/main/AndroidManifest.xml
+7
-21
mobile/src/main/java/cn/garymb/ygomobile/ui/home/HomeActivity.java
...c/main/java/cn/garymb/ygomobile/ui/home/HomeActivity.java
+11
-6
mobile/src/main/java/cn/garymb/ygomobile/ui/preference/fragments/SettingFragment.java
...mb/ygomobile/ui/preference/fragments/SettingFragment.java
+11
-4
mobile/src/main/res/xml/update_apk_path.xml
mobile/src/main/res/xml/update_apk_path.xml
+0
-4
No files found.
build.gradle
View file @
d9556126
...
...
@@ -23,6 +23,7 @@ allprojects {
jcenter
()
google
()
maven
{
url
"https://jitpack.io"
}
maven
{
url
"https://raw.githubusercontent.com/Pgyer/mvn_repo_pgyer/master"
}
}
}
...
...
mobile/assets/changelog.html
View file @
d9556126
...
...
@@ -28,6 +28,7 @@
修复:
1.若干已知卡图错误;
2.本地脚本问题;
3.更换自动更新源;
优化:
1.把过去的更新日志删了加快初启动速度;
2.可以自行设置头像;
...
...
mobile/build.gradle
View file @
d9556126
...
...
@@ -8,7 +8,7 @@ android {
applicationId
"cn.garymb.ygomobile"
minSdkVersion
16
targetSdkVersion
22
versionCode
3303072
2
versionCode
3303072
3
versionName
"3.3.3"
flavorDimensions
"versionCode"
vectorDrawables
.
useSupportLibrary
=
true
...
...
mobile/libs/360update-7.0.3.jar
deleted
100644 → 0
View file @
4b261507
File deleted
mobile/libs/armeabi-v7a/libarmeabi.so
deleted
100644 → 0
View file @
4b261507
File deleted
mobile/libs/pgyer_sdk_3.0.0.jar
0 → 100644
View file @
d9556126
File added
mobile/src/main/AndroidManifest.xml
View file @
d9556126
...
...
@@ -10,6 +10,7 @@
<uses-permission
android:name=
"android.permission.ACCESS_NETWORK_STATE"
/>
<uses-permission
android:name=
"android.permission.WAKE_LOCK"
/>
<uses-permission
android:name=
"android.permission.READ_LOGS"
/>
<uses-permission
android:name=
"android.permission.RECORD_AUDIO"
/>
<uses-permission
android:name=
"android.permission.VIBRATE"
/>
<uses-permission
android:name=
"android.permission.WRITE_SETTINGS"
/>
<uses-permission
android:name=
"android.permission.GET_TASKS"
/>
...
...
@@ -190,29 +191,14 @@
android:screenOrientation=
"behind"
android:windowSoftInputMode=
"adjustResize|stateHidden"
>
</activity>
<activity
android:name=
"com.qihoo.appstore.common.updatesdk.lib.UpdateTipDialogActivity"
android:configChanges=
"keyboardHidden|orientation|screenSize"
android:exported=
"false"
android:screenOrientation=
"portrait"
android:theme=
"@android:style/Theme.Translucent.NoTitleBar"
/>
<service
android:name=
"com.qihoo.appstore.updatelib.CheckUpdateService"
android:exported=
"false"
/>
<provider
android:name=
"com.qihoo.appstore.updatelib.UpdateProvider"
android:authorities=
"cn.garymb.ygomobile"
android:grantUriPermissions=
"true"
android:exported=
"false"
>
android:name=
"com.pgyersdk.PgyerProvider"
android:authorities=
"${applicationId}.com.pgyer.provider"
android:exported=
"false"
/>
<meta-data
android:name=
"android.support.FILE_PROVIDER_PATHS"
android:resource=
"@xml/update_apk_path"
/>
</provider>
android:name=
"PGYER_APPID"
android:value=
"dd147e8542b85a64111d98290892d8bd"
>
</meta-data>
</application>
</manifest>
\ No newline at end of file
mobile/src/main/java/cn/garymb/ygomobile/ui/home/HomeActivity.java
View file @
d9556126
...
...
@@ -10,6 +10,7 @@ import android.support.design.widget.NavigationView;
import
android.support.v7.widget.DividerItemDecoration
;
import
android.support.v7.widget.LinearLayoutManager
;
import
android.text.TextUtils
;
import
android.util.Log
;
import
android.util.SparseArray
;
import
android.view.Gravity
;
import
android.view.Menu
;
...
...
@@ -27,7 +28,10 @@ import com.base.bj.trpayjar.utils.TrPay;
import
com.nightonke.boommenu.BoomButtons.BoomButton
;
import
com.nightonke.boommenu.BoomButtons.TextOutsideCircleButton
;
import
com.nightonke.boommenu.BoomMenuButton
;
import
com.qihoo.appstore.common.updatesdk.lib.UpdateHelper
;
import
com.pgyersdk.update.DownloadFileListener
;
import
com.pgyersdk.update.PgyUpdateManager
;
import
com.pgyersdk.update.UpdateManagerListener
;
import
com.pgyersdk.update.javabean.AppBean
;
import
com.tencent.smtt.sdk.QbSdk
;
import
com.tubb.smrv.SwipeMenuRecyclerView
;
...
...
@@ -387,11 +391,12 @@ abstract class HomeActivity extends BaseActivity implements NavigationView.OnNav
mMenuIds
.
put
(
mMenuIds
.
size
(),
menuId
);
}
private
void
checkForceUpdateSilent
()
{
UpdateHelper
.
getInstance
().
init
(
getContext
(),
Color
.
parseColor
(
"#0A93DB"
));
UpdateHelper
.
getInstance
().
setDebugMode
(
false
);
long
intervalMillis
=
0
*
1000L
;
UpdateHelper
.
getInstance
().
autoUpdate
(
getPackageName
(),
false
,
intervalMillis
);
public
void
checkForceUpdateSilent
()
{
new
PgyUpdateManager
.
Builder
()
.
setForced
(
false
)
//设置是否强制更新
.
setUserCanRetry
(
false
)
//失败后是否提示重新下载
.
setDeleteHistroyApk
(
true
)
// 检查更新前是否删除本地历史 Apk
.
register
();
}
public
void
AnimationShake
()
{
...
...
mobile/src/main/java/cn/garymb/ygomobile/ui/preference/fragments/SettingFragment.java
View file @
d9556126
...
...
@@ -23,7 +23,11 @@ import android.widget.Toast;
import
com.bumptech.glide.Glide
;
import
com.bumptech.glide.load.engine.DiskCacheStrategy
;
import
com.bumptech.glide.signature.StringSignature
;
import
com.qihoo.appstore.common.updatesdk.lib.UpdateHelper
;
import
com.pgyersdk.update.DownloadFileListener
;
import
com.pgyersdk.update.PgyUpdateManager
;
import
com.pgyersdk.update.UpdateManagerListener
;
import
com.pgyersdk.update.javabean.AppBean
;
import
java.io.File
;
import
java.io.FileInputStream
;
...
...
@@ -178,9 +182,12 @@ public class SettingFragment extends PreferenceFragmentPlus {
.
show
();
}
if
(
PREF_CHECK_UPDATE
.
equals
(
preference
.
getKey
()))
{
UpdateHelper
.
getInstance
().
init
(
getContext
(),
Color
.
parseColor
(
"#0A93DB"
));
UpdateHelper
.
getInstance
().
setDebugMode
(
false
);
UpdateHelper
.
getInstance
().
manualUpdate
(
"cn.garymb.ygomobile"
);
new
PgyUpdateManager
.
Builder
()
.
setForced
(
true
)
//设置是否强制更新,非自定义回调更新接口此方法有用
.
setUserCanRetry
(
true
)
//失败后是否提示重新下载,非自定义下载 apk 回调此方法有用
.
setDeleteHistroyApk
(
true
)
// 检查更新前是否删除本地历史 Apk, 默认为true
.
register
();
}
if
(
PREF_PENDULUM_SCALE
.
equals
(
key
))
{
...
...
mobile/src/main/res/xml/update_apk_path.xml
deleted
100644 → 0
View file @
4b261507
<?xml version="1.0" encoding="utf-8"?>
<paths
xmlns:android=
"http://schemas.android.com/apk/res/android"
>
<cache-path
name=
"qihoo_update"
path=
"360Download/"
/>
</paths>
\ No newline at end of file
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ment